SCOPE

The Legacy Journal of Interdisciplinary Studies welcomes submissions from a wide range of disciplines, encouraging contributions that blend insights from various fields to address complex issues. The journal publishes a variety of manuscript types, including original research articles, literature reviews, theoretical essays, case studies, and commentaries. Topics of interest include, but are not limited to:
